Output 893403ec1047ab216196e5b7a45dc5cf56e0735650438eff5d31c5b3c43de1af:64

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4f5a634a93769beafd1c989e18f89f7c0a99db82bf8e5840715297030c01d264
address
bc1pfadxxj5nw6d74lgunz0p37yl0s9fnkuzh789ssr322tsxrqp6fjqynjlcm
transaction
893403ec1047ab216196e5b7a45dc5cf56e0735650438eff5d31c5b3c43de1af
spent
true